Broken Record of Conviction

 
Our son is nearly two years old and absolutely loves the song: "I Need Thee Every Hour."

I need Thee, oh, I need Thee;
Ev’ry hour I need Thee!
Oh, bless me now, my Savior;
I come to Thee!


It's to the point where he asks for it every time we're in the car, sings portions of it while walking around the room, and requests that we do the same when putting him in bed. His persistence is admirable!

The other day he had asked to play it again in the car - at least five or six times - and the track was starting to wear a little thin. Then, my wife said something amazing:

"I think his love for this song is helping me remember how much I need Him."

It was not one day later that I had a similar experience, hearing the truth of the lyrics echo out of the mouths of this babe in our midst.

Parenting can be a hard task, but it is a long game; the momentary phases our children go through really are just drops in the bucket. When we look at this portion of his life as a season, we see more clearly into the heart of a sinner who does indeed need Christ.

Therefore, since we have a great high priest who has ascended into heaven, Jesus the Son of God, let us hold firmly to the faith we profess. For we do not have a high priest who is unable to empathize with our weaknesses, but we have one who has been tempted in every way, just as we are—yet he did not sin. Let us then approach God’s throne of grace with confidence, so that we may receive mercy and find grace to help us in our time of need.
Hebrews 4:14-16


Plus...there are far worse songs that he could request to play on repeat, memorize in chunks, and hear us affirm before bedtime. Our need for Him is great and should be on our minds, indeed, every single hour.
